What this job involves:

As a Maintenance Attendant within Building Operations, Engineering Services at JLL, you'll be an essential part of the team ensuring optimal facility performance and a well-maintained environment for our clients. This hands-on role combines technical skill with practical problem-solving to address the daily maintenance needs that keep commercial properties running smoothly and looking their best. Working under the direction of the Chief Engineer, Assistant Chief Engineer, or Operating Engineer, you'll perform a wide range of maintenance tasks including plumbing repairs, general upkeep, painting, cleaning mechanical spaces, and minor repairs to building systems and fixtures. At JLL, we are collectively shaping a brighter way - for our clients, ourselves and our fellow employees, and this position plays a vital role in that mission by maintaining the physical environments that support productivity and comfort. You'll be responsible for responding to maintenance requests promptly, using your versatility and handyman skills to resolve issues efficiently while maintaining high standards of workmanship. This is an opportunity to apply your practical maintenance knowledge in a collaborative environment where your contributions directly impact the day-to-day operations and appearance of commercial real estate properties.

What your day-to-day will look like:

  • Perform repairs and maintenance on restroom facilities including fixing soap dispensers, clearing drains using plungers or handheld augers, and addressing other plumbing-related issues to ensure functional, clean facilities
  • Conduct general labor tasks such as carrying, stacking, and sorting materials used in and around the jobsite, as well as debris removal to maintain organized and safe work areas
  • Travel using employer-supplied vehicle to pick up parts, supplies, and materials needed to complete maintenance tasks efficiently and minimize downtime
  • Repair and maintain building components including registers, radiators, door hardware, furniture, floors, floor maintenance equipment, and venetian blinds to preserve property appearance and functionality
  • Perform maintenance painting in equipment rooms, cooling towers, and other building facilities including touch-up work to maintain professional aesthetics throughout the property
  • Clean and maintain mechanical spaces, perimeter induction units, and jobsites using various equipment such as vacuums, mops, brooms, floor scrubbers, waxers, steam cleaners, and high-pressure spray cleaners
  • Complete miscellaneous handyman work requiring limited use of hand tools and hang framed objects using cordless drill/drivers to address tenant requests and building needs
  • Clean and paint non-operating mechanical equipment that has been properly shut down, locked out, and tagged by a Journeyman Engineer in strict accordance with safety lockout procedures
  • Respond to after-hours and emergency maintenance requests on weekends and during off-hours as needed to support continuous building operations in a 24/7 environment
